Short description

The Math Guy was founded by a group of former RI and HCI schoolmates. It currently offers Mathematics, Chemistry and Biology. Its Mathematics programme specialises in students on the IP pathway. School-level Mathematics classes are grouped by school and year, so students from different schools are not mixed. Physics is planned once a suitable tutor is appointed and is not currently offered.

What makes the model different

  • School-specific grouping: students are separated by school and year, and different schools are not mixed. Lessons can therefore follow the relevant topic order, pace and exam style.
  • Visible working: shared digital whiteboards let the tutor see every step of every student's working in real time, so misconceptions are corrected as they appear. See Why We Insist on Teaching Online.
  • Focused one-hour lessons: each lesson diagnoses gaps, explains concisely and retests, keeping the attempt-feedback-fix cycle inside a single session. See Learning Loops.
